public class SignatureDataInjector extends SignatureDataExtractor
Modifier and Type | Field and Description |
---|---|
protected byte[] |
oldSignatureData |
protected byte[] |
signature |
byteRange, certificate, date, pdfFilter, pdfSubFilter, signatureData
Constructor and Description |
---|
SignatureDataInjector(iaik.x509.X509Certificate certificate,
String filter,
String subfilter,
Calendar date,
byte[] signature,
byte[] signatureData) |
Modifier and Type | Method and Description |
---|---|
byte[] |
sign(InputStream content) |
getByteRange, getCertificate, getPDFFilter, getPDFSubFilter, getSignatureData, getSigningDate, setPDSignature
protected byte[] signature
protected byte[] oldSignatureData
public byte[] sign(InputStream content) throws org.apache.pdfbox.exceptions.SignatureException, IOException
sign
in interface org.apache.pdfbox.pdmodel.interactive.digitalsignature.SignatureInterface
sign
in class SignatureDataExtractor
org.apache.pdfbox.exceptions.SignatureException
IOException